Join Us in Shaping the Future of Insurance Professionals!

We are excited to invite you to participate in the 2024-2025 CISR High School Program, an initiative designed to bridge the gap between education and the insurance industry by connecting professionals like yourself with high school students eager to learn.

Your expertise and career journey can make a significant impact as a classroom speaker, mentor, or by offering work-based learning (WBL) opportunities.

Types of Volunteer Opportunities:

Classroom Speakers

Seeking passionate industry professionals to share their career experiences and knowledge with students. Speakers are needed at all levels and areas of the industry. The CISR High School Program covers five primary modules: Elements of Risk Management, Personal Auto, Personal Residential, Commercial Property and Casualty, and Life & Health. You can enhance students’ education by bringing real-life experiences to these areas.

Work-Based Learning (WBL)

High school students often need to complete work-based learning hours as part of their graduation requirements. These opportunities, which can range from shadow days to internships or part-time positions, are the hardest to come by in the insurance industry. The Alliance will support employers in structuring a WBL experience that benefits both the employer and the student.

Virtual Volunteers

Unable to participate in person? We welcome virtual volunteers who are interested in speaking to students remotely or recording short videos that can be used throughout the program. Your virtual presence can still have a profound impact, bringing your insights and experiences directly to students, regardless of location.

Mentorship

Mentors play a pivotal role in shaping the next generation by providing insights, guidance, and career advice. Mentorship opportunities will vary by school, and expressing interest does not commit you immediately. We will contact you with more details before pairing you with a student.
